University Basketball: The NCAA Landscape
Powerhouse Packages Direct the Pack
In NCAA Division I Gals’s basketball, the most notable plans—Consider South Carolina, LSU, UConn, and Stanford—boast not simply championship pedigree but also some of the optimum-paid out head coaches from the Activity. By way of example:

Dawn Staley (South Carolina) reportedly earns about $3 million every year, producing her one of the highest-paid out coaches inside the Girls's match. Her good results within the court and job in advancing the sport has produced her payment a benchmark while in the market.

Kim Mulkey (LSU) also commands a multi-million greenback contract, reflecting her Corridor of Fame resume and ability to make title-contending systems.

Geno Auriemma (UConn), one of many winningest coaches in history, contains a wage that exceeds $two million per year, which include bonuses and endorsements.

The Mid-Key Gap
Although best-tier coaches in the Power 5 conferences are now securing multi-million dollar deals, mid-key faculties normally can’t compete with these types of figures. Head coaches at smaller sized courses could get paid amongst $one hundred,000 and $three hundred,000, based upon location, faculty dimensions, and good results amount.

Lots of of these coaches wear a number of hats—managing recruiting, administrative obligations, and at times even educational aid—which isn’t usually reflected within their compensation.

Qualified Basketball: The WNBA
A Smaller League, A Smaller sized Paycheck
The WNBA, even though rising in popularity and investment decision, operates over a Substantially lesser financial scale compared to the NBA. Because of this, even head coaches with the Specialist stage receive appreciably a lot less than their college or university counterparts or NBA equivalents.

As of 2024, most WNBA head coaches get paid during the number of $a hundred and fifty,000 to $300,000 annually. This amount may vary according to experience, team performance, and negotiation competencies.

The very best-paid WNBA head coaches, such as Becky Hammon of your Las Vegas Aces, reportedly gain all around $1 million on a yearly basis, a big outlier manufactured achievable by a mix of accomplishment and marketability.

Bonuses and Additional Payment
Most coaching contracts contain overall performance-centered bonuses for such things as playoff appearances, championships, and coach-of-the-12 months honors. Endorsements and media appearances can also insert supplemental cash flow, especially for superior-profile coaches.

Spend Fairness in Coaching: The Gender Hole
Just about the most mentioned issues on the globe of athletics may be the pay disparity involving Guys’s and girls’s basketball coaches—even when they work at the same establishment.

As an example, at many universities, the Adult men’s basketball head coach can make two to 5 occasions more than the Women of all ages’s coach, Inspite of equivalent documents or achievements concentrations. Occasionally, athletic departments argue this is because of revenue era differences. Even so, critics indicate that disparities in marketing and advertising, means, and media coverage Perform a task in Those people extremely profits dissimilarities.

Current lawsuits and community force have prompted some schools to assessment fork out buildings and regulate accordingly. The hope is the fact that as Girls's basketball carries on to realize traction, the payment for its leaders will improved replicate their benefit and contributions.
